Overcoming Fears

Many people are leery of the speed at which the US Food and Drug Administration authorized both Moderna and Pfizer and BioNTech’s coronavirus vaccines. We have a population that is still unsure that they should be vaccinated. This concern will stall any hope of getting out of this pandemic.

Herd immunity, or population immunity, happens when substantial proportion of the population is vaccinated. According to the Mayo Clinic, 70 percent of the population needs to either contract COVID-19 or be vaccinated; meaning 200 million people would have to recover or be vaccinated. We need the public to feel confident in getting the vaccines to achieve this.

The average development time for a vaccine is 10 to 15 years. Photo: AFP

Another hurdle to overcome focuses on those who have conveyed their apprehension about being the so-called “guinea pigs.” Many feel these vaccines have been rushed, but what we need to articulate better is many pharmaceutical companies have been working and studying coronaviruses for decades in their labs.
